1. TAVO Next
The TAVO Next is a budget friendly stroller that can accommodate children as heavy as 50 pounds. It's incredibly spacious, and the seat reclines very easily and lays flat. It's also simple to open and close and has an XXL canopy with venting and windows that peek out. Nuna updated the TAVO harness for 2021 with Magnetech Secure Snap. This allows it to be secured safely and easily with one hand.
The TAVO is a good choice for parents who want to save money. However, it's not the best choice if you require a reversible or bassinet seat. It only faces one way and doesn't allow for a car seat, or other accessories like the bassinet stand or cup holder, rain cover or a child's snack tray. The MIXX Next is the better option for those who want more because it can accommodate these accessories.
You can travel far or near and take baby from car to curb using the TAVO's built in Free-flex suspension to ensure a smooth ride. The spacious, deluxe seat lets baby relax and drift off into dreamland. Parents will also appreciate the small fold-away axle as well as MagneTech Secure Snap.
The TAVO is incredibly easy to fold and stands upright in folded position and can be used to free up spaces like garages, closets or trunks. It is also easy to maneuver and comes with a handy basket for storage and brakes that are flip-flop-friendly. It also connects directly to the very secure Nuna PIPA series car seats by a single click, no adapters are required for a sleek travel set-up.
2. UPPAbaby Vista v2
The UPPAbaby Vista V2 is one of our top-rated full-size strollers. It is an excellent choice for families who have children who are growing up because it can be used with a bassinet, infant car seat and toddler seats. This stroller is also able to accept a riding board to turn it into triple strollers.
The padded seats in this stroller are designed for comfort. The recline is easy to operate and comes with four set positions, making it adjustable for the child's requirements. The foot rest also adjusts to give passengers an easier ride. The canopy is huge and is a major bonus for parents looking to protect their kids from the sun. It is SPF 50+-rated and has a pop-out-visor, two mesh windows that peek out, and a flap cover that can be adjusted.
Another fantastic aspect of the UPPAbaby Vista V2 is that its fabric can be washed in the machine. This is crucial because it helps extend the life of your stroller, so you can enjoy many years of use out of it. It is also easier to clean up messes such as spills of juice or food, rather than having to scrub away the stains that are stubborn.
The new tires of UPPAbaby are larger and more comfortable than the previous models, which makes for more comfortable riding. They can handle rough terrain with ease and minimize vibrations when you're moving through the city. The brakes feature an uni-directional design and are easy to use. They also have small, color-coded foot pedal that can be used with all kinds of footwear.

3. Cybex Gazelle
The Cybex Gazelle is an excellent option for parents who want to invest in a stroller that will expand with their family. It's classified as to be a "modular stroller" or "convertible stroller" It comes with more than 20 different designs for use with various seats, cots, and infant car seats (car seat pushchair 2 in 1 adapters for seats are sold separately).
We are awestruck by the fact that the Cybex Gazelle is light and easy to move around which makes it ideal for parents who like to go out and explore. It also comes with a large storage basket beneath and a variety of attachments to allow parents to take their grocery items or light shopping with the. It's a bit more expensive than the other two in one prams but it's worth the cost because the quality and function are top-of-the-line.
The stroller comes with a single-pull safety harness that makes it simple to secure your child into the seat. It also comes with an adjustable sun canopy that has peek-a-boo and XXL panels. It also has a practical parent tray to hold drinks, snacks and phones. The telescopic handlebar adjusts to suit the height of parents, and the brake is easy to access which makes it safe for children to operate.
Our mum tester Sophie from London used this stroller with her two daughters aged 5 and 10 months. She took it on uneven, hilly terrain and cobbled roads and found the stroller to be very smooth and easy to maneuver. She loved that the padded seats and footrests are ergonomically designed for comfort and the large shopping basket was practical. She also appreciated that the fabrics on the handlebars and hood were machine washable. This is essential for busy parents.
4. Joovy Twin Roo+
The Twin Roo+ is a frame stroller with a minimalist design that provides car seat compatibility. It also has an enormous storage container. It is one of the lightest double strollers on the market. It weighs 24 pounds without infant car seat attachments, which is on the lighter side for a double stroller. It is slightly heavier than both the UPPAbaby V2 double and the Thule Urban Glide 2 in 1 pram sale double.
The Roo+ comes with a quick-start guide, and is easy to use. It snaps together easily and can be on the road within less than 10 minutes. It doesn't come with an integrated canopy which means your kids will require their own sunshades if they require extra protection from the elements.
Through our tests, we discovered that the Roo+ was a dual stroller that performed well. It can maneuver through all types of terrain, but it can be difficult on grassy areas and over gravel. It can also be hard to steer over and up curbs that are 1 inch in height. This stroller is not recommended for use on the stairs or off-road, however its suspension system can help to minimize bumps.
Although the Roo+ has a large under-seat storage container but it's not easy to access without taking off the infant car seats. This is a problem twin frame strollers commonly face however Joovy provides an additional underseat baby carrier to help solve this issue.
Unlike top-scoring strollers, the Roo+ doesn't have a self-standing fold or cup holders. This is a small sacrifice for car seat compatibility and storage features however we'd prefer to have a bit more flexibility from our strollers. The stroller's flexibility in seating configuration is a big benefit. Parents can put their infant car seats either the opposite direction or in the same direction, depending on their needs.
5. Delta Children LX Side-by-Side
The Delta Children LX Side by Side scored a high score for both weight and folded size, making it the best value in our double umbrella stroller review. It also scores well in maneuverability which is a crucial feature for parents who are seeking a travel stroller that can be tucked away in small spaces. The Delta is a basic model, lacking some features other strollers we tried offer, such as a large storage basket or a wide recline. However, it's a great choice for families with a limited budget and for those who require an additional stroller for occasional use, such as going to the zoo for a day.
The LX Side-by-Side is a lightweight and compact stroller. It is easy to turn and push. Its short frame, rotating wheels in the front and padded shoulder pad provide an easy ride. The multi-position reclining seats and cup holders for parents ensure that passengers are comfortable.
It also has a large European-style canopy that provides shade from the sun and some protection from light winds. It also comes with two storage bags and a five-point safety harness and two storage bags.
The Delta took less than three minutes to put together which is the quickest time of our test group. The manual is fairly basic and doesn't require any tools for assembly. It is among our lighter products and folds flat, making it easy to lift and transport.
